Grady Sizemore: From Diamondbacks intern to White Sox Interim Manager
Joe Camporeale-USA TODAY Sports

Grady Sizemore’s career in baseball took an unexpected turn when he went from being a three-time All-Star to an intern for $15 per hour with the Arizona Diamondbacks. Now, after the team fired head coach Pedro Grifol following a 21-game losing streak, Sizemore is the interim manager of the struggling Chicago White Sox.

Sizemore was one of baseball’s biggest stars from 2005 to 2008, winning two Gold Gloves, a Silver Slugger Award, and three selections to the All-Star team. With 134 runs and 53 doubles in 2013, he was the league leader. But a string of injuries wrecked his career, forcing him to retire early in 2015 at the age of thirty-two.

After stepping away for a couple of years to spend time with his family, Sizemore had the urge to get back into the game. He got in touch with Josh Barfield, his old Cleveland teammate who was the Arizona Diamondbacks’ director of player development at the time, in 2023. Sizemore took a low-paying internship with the Diamondbacks even though they had no openings in order to regain his reputation. Sizemore had already moved to the Phoenix area at the time, owning a home in Scottsdale, Arizona.

With the Diamondbacks, Sizemore put in a lot of work, visiting minor-league affiliates and working primarily with outfielders and baserunners at the team’s training complex.

That next step came sooner than expected. When Josh Barfield, was hired as the assistant general manager of the Chicago White Sox in September 2023, he recommended Sizemore for a coaching position on Pedro Grifol’s staff. By November, Sizemore was on the White Sox coaching staff, primarily working with outfielders and helping coach baserunning.

Less than a year later, Sizemore is now the head coach of one of the worst teams in MLB history on an interim basis. It is quite the accomplishment for the former three-time All-Star to go from making $15 per hour as an intern to managing a major league team.
